What is Executive Coaching?

Executive coaching is a one-on-one professional relationship between a coach and an executive designed to enhance leadership skills, improve decision-making, and increase overall effectiveness. The purpose of executive coaching is to help leaders identify their strengths and weaknesses, set goals, develop action plans, and provide ongoing support to achieve desired outcomes. Coaches work with executives to enhance self-awareness, build confidence, and improve communication and interpersonal skills.

Coaching sessions are typically tailored to the individual’s specific needs and may focus on areas such as strategic thinking, emotional intelligence, conflict resolution, time management, and performance feedback. Coaches use a variety of techniques, including assessments, goal-setting, role-playing, feedback, and accountability to support executives in their professional growth and development.

What is Executive Training?

Executive training is a structured developmental program designed to provide leaders with the knowledge, skills, and tools they need to succeed in their roles. Training programs may cover a range of topics, including leadership development, communication, team building, strategic planning, change management, and conflict resolution. They are typically delivered through workshops, seminars, online courses, and on-the-job training.

Executive training programs are designed to help leaders acquire new skills, expand their knowledge, and stay current with industry trends and best practices. They provide opportunities for executives to network with peers, share experiences, and learn from experts in their field. Training programs also help leaders develop a growth mindset, embrace change, and adapt to new challenges and opportunities.
